@markfed7
Fun, challenging, and a good hike. Pros: -Large tees, good baskets, and benches throughout -some excellent wooded holes (2, 5, 10, 11, 12, and 16) -a pair of bomber more open holes to break up all the woods -challenging Par 3 design without only requiring distance -short tees have had though put into their placement -uphills are mostly between holes so you get a lot more downhill shots than up Cons: -2 holes that interact with the main road dangerously (8 & 9) -a couple wooded holes need just a few more trees removed to make fair lines (10, 11, 14, & 17) -Pin positions that drastically change par/difficulty are not a design choice that I care for unless you have a basket permanently in the different par position. -No indicator which pin is in play at tee signs Overall inspired and fun design. Will definitely be back!

@irbium1
One of the most difficult courses I've played so far, and that was just the short holes. Extremely amount of hill walking. The hole lengths are punishing for such thick tree coverage. It is almost impossible to design a shot. The tree lanes are snake-shaped. You might design a shot to hit the first two turns in a lane, but not the third. This is also the most I've ever hit trees. If you do well here, you are very good.
